Add 12/50 and 42/7

1st number: 12/50, 2nd number: 6 0/7

12/50 + 42/7 is 156/25.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 50 and 7 is 350

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 350
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 50 × 7 = 350,
    12/50 = 12 × 7/50 × 7 = 84/350
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 7 × 50 = 350,
    42/7 = 42 × 50/7 × 50 = 2100/350
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    84/350 + 2100/350 = 84 + 2100/350 = 2184/350
  5. 2184/350 simplified gives 156/25
  6. So, 12/50 + 42/7 = 156/25
